Transaction 20a20496bdfa4616c98851855e90f317770b9746c2959977250cc531d1208a02

2 Input
2 Outputs
  • 20a20496bdfa4616c98851855e90f317770b9746c2959977250cc531d1208a02:0
  • value  1000000
    address  1M7qcnGNtVDqrXfKvAwwgu2zfWhijrrkRx
  • 20a20496bdfa4616c98851855e90f317770b9746c2959977250cc531d1208a02:1
  • value  6116514
    address  1PkfPMgkQGGV9u9qmTju1h7gi7MCJ4k2SD